Għadira Nature Reserve is a breathtakingly beautiful sanctuary located in Mellieħa, Malta, celebrated for its rich biodiversity and tranquil environment. This national reserve serves as a critical habitat for various bird species and is particularly renowned for its vibrant birdlife. As you stroll through the reserve, you'll encounter a diverse range of habitats, including lush wetlands, sandy beaches, and extensive salt marshes, all teeming with wildlife. The reserve is a haven for nature lovers, offering ample opportunities for birdwatching, photography, and peaceful reflection amidst the serene landscapes. One of the highlights of visiting Għadira Nature Reserve is the chance to observe migratory birds in their natural habitat, especially during the spring and autumn months. You may spot a wide array of species, including herons, ducks, and wading birds, making it a paradise for avid birdwatchers. The reserve also features informative signage and designated viewing areas that enhance the visitor experience, allowing you to learn more about the local flora and fauna.
